Combine the natural wonders of the Louisiana swamps with the historic charm of Oak Alley Plantation.

Getting started

Meet your guide for narrated transportation to Oak Alley Plantation. Proceed to your next adventure to Manchac Swamp; after a safety briefing, board the covered airboat for your guided wildlife experience cruise.

What to expect

Full-day Plantation & Swamp Adventure:

Step back into Louisiana’s antebellum past at the iconic Oak Alley Plantation, then glide through the wildlife-rich Manchac Swamp on a covered pontoon boat. Learn about Cajun culture, local history, and spot alligators, raccoons, and other wildlife along the way.

Features

  • Guided plantation tour: Explore the Big House and learn the history of its families and former inhabitants.

  • Self-guided grounds: Stroll through gardens, reconstructed slave cabins, and exhibits at your own pace.

  • Narrated swamp cruise: Experience a relaxing boat ride with expert commentary on local wildlife and culture.

  • Wildlife spotting: Keep an eye out for alligators, raccoons, and other native animals in their natural habitat.

  • Convenient transport: Round-trip narrated bus transport from New Orleans ensures a stress-free day.

Accessibility

  • Collapsible wheelchairs can be stored on the bus, while scooters require 48 hours’ prior notice.

  • Access to the plantation’s second floor is only available via stairs.

  • Airboats are not accessible for wheelchairs and lack ramps or lifts.

  • Guests must be able to board the airboat on their own or with help from their companions.

  • Airboat rides are not advised for pregnant women or those with heart, back, or serious medical conditions.

  • Service animals may accompany guests, though they are discouraged on airboats due to noise and nearby wildlife.

Additional information

  • Tours run in all weather conditions and are only canceled when deemed unsafe.

  • Children under the age of 6 who do not occupy a seat may join free of charge.

  • Passengers must be at least 48 inches tall to take part in the airboat ride.

  • Wildlife sightings, including alligators, are seasonal and most frequent in spring, summer, and fall.
